如何在代码中使用Visual Studio中创建的数据连接?

时间:2010-02-27 09:59:45

标签: .net visual-studio-2008 settings database-connection

是否可以访问代码中添加到项目中的数据连接?

我知道可以访问使用可视化设计器创建的DataSet,但我只想访问该连接。

编辑:

可以通过工具>将数据连接添加到VS2008中的项目中。连接数据库。

我想在我的代码中将此连接作为对象访问,这样我就不必自己指定连接字符串了。

1 个答案:

答案 0 :(得分:6)

我认为您不能直接使用IDE创建的连接,就好像它是您项目的设置之一一样。但是,IDE通过项目属性提供类似的功能。

您对属性的了解程度因您使用的语言/默认配置而异。但一般来说,您应该能够尝试这些步骤,看看它们是否提供了您想要的功能:

  1. 打开您的项目。
  2. 在解决方案资源管理器中找到您的项目并选择项目。
  3. 在“项目”菜单上,选择“ProjectName”“属性”菜单项。
  4. 应打开项目属性选项卡。选择“设置”刀片。
  5. 如果您没有设置,您将可以选择创建设置文件。如有必要,请这样做。
  6. 在显示的网格中,选择第一个空白行,并在名称字段中键入“ConnectionString”。
  7. 在类型下拉列表中,选择(连接字符串)
  8. 单击值字段。激活此字段时,应显示标有“...”的小扩展按钮。点击它。
  9. 这将打开一个“连接设置”对话框。
  10. 从可用的下拉菜单中选择您的服务器。
  11. 根据自己的喜好配置登录凭据。
  12. 从可用的下拉列表中选择您的数据库。
  13. 测试连接。如果没问题,则单击“确定”两次返回设置页面。
  14. 保存您的设置。
  15. 现在您应该能够从项目代码中访问此连接字符串。

    VB.Net:

    Dim cs = My.Settings.ConnectionString
    

    C#:

    var cs = Properties.Settings.Default.ConnectionString;